#3210. 和谐串

和谐串

Description

nzk发现0和1个数相同的01串有呼唤世界和平的魔力,于是他称这种01串是和谐的。对于一个长度为2n的01串,如

果它的最长和谐前缀长度为L(如果它没有任何一个和谐前缀,则L = 0),那么这个串的魔力值即为(1 / (2n + 1

  • L))。你的任务是计算,随机等概率地生成一个长度为2n的01串的话,它的魔力值的期望是多少。

Format

Input

第一行一个整数T,表示测试点的数目。每个测试点包含一个正整数。

Output

输出T行,每行对应一组数据的答案,要求输出的数符合 %le格式。与标准答案相对误差在10^-6内算正确.

Samples

1
2
0.533333

Limitation

样例说明 若输出5.33333e-01或0.0533333e+01等等也是可以的。 数据范围与约定 对于100% 的数据,N <= 10^16,输入文件大小不超过 1MB。